Pea gravel delivery services involve the transportation and placement of small, rounded stones that are commonly used for landscaping, pathways, driveways, and decorative features. These services typically include the delivery of bulk quantities of pea gravel directly to a property, ensuring the material arrives ready for use. Contractors experienced in this work can also assist with the proper spreading and leveling of the gravel to create a smooth, stable surface. This makes it easier for homeowners to undertake projects without the hassle of sourcing and transporting the gravel themselves.
Using pea gravel delivery can help solve several common property problems. It provides an affordable and low-maintenance solution for creating durable walkways and driveways that drain well and resist erosion. Additionally, pea gravel can be used to improve drainage around foundations or in garden beds, reducing water pooling and soil erosion issues. For properties that require a decorative touch, the uniform appearance and natural color of pea gravel offer an attractive way to enhance landscaping features, making outdoor spaces more functional and visually appealing.

The overview below groups typical Pea Gravel Delivery proj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or pea gravel repairs or topping off existing areas,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and accessibility of the area.
Medium-sized Projects - Installing pea gravel for pathways, small patios, or garden beds usually costs between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common and often fall into the middle of the typical cost spectrum.
Large Installations - Larger projects such as extensive walkways or multiple yard sections can range from $1,500 to $3,000. While more complex jobs can push beyond this range, most projects stay within this band.
Full Replacement or Commercial Jobs - Complete yard overhauls or commercial-scale pea gravel delivery can cost $3,000 and up, with larger, more complex projects reaching $5,000 or more. Fewer projects reach these higher tiers, but they are available for substantial or specialized work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
